About Murray Hill Four Corners Park

Murray Hill Four Corners Park is located in the Murray Hill Heights area of west Jacksonville. Murray Hill Heights is a 1907 replat of the northern section of the Edgewood subdivision platted in the 1880’s. The town of Murray Hill incorporated in 1916 and remained a separate municipality until its annexation by the City of Jacksonville in 1925. The City acquired the park property in six deeds between 1925 and 1939. The passive park takes its name from the property’s location at the four corners of the Lawnview Street and Lamboll Avenue intersection. With input and assistance from the Murray Hill Preservation Association, the City completed an improvement project in 1995 that included a lighted walking and jogging trail (internal to the park), and new benches, irrigation spigots, and trash receptacles.
